Kjell Arvid Svendsen

Kjell Arvid Svendsen (born 27 August 1953 in Haugesund) is a Norwegian schoolteacher and politician for the Christian Democratic Party.

He was a son of manager Karl Sigfred Svendsen and housewife Anny Kristine Levinsen.

He also served as a deputy representative to the Parliament of Norway from Rogaland during the terms 2005–2009 and 2009–2013; meeting regularly in October 2005 while Dagfinn Høybråten was still a member of the outgoing Bondevik's Second Cabinet.

He has been active in the Norwegian Lutheran Inner Mission Society and a board member of the companies Gassnor (1996–2004), Haugaland Bompengeselskap (chairman, since 2001), KLP Skadeforsikring (since 2005) and Fonna Health Trust (since 2006).
